WebLiving with a Brother or Sister with Special Needs: A Book for Siblings, by Donald Meyer and Patricia Vadasy. May be useful for both parents and children to read. Brothers and Sisters: A Special Part of Exceptional Families, by Thomas Powell and Peggy Gallagher. Siblings Without Rivalry, by Adele Faber and Elaine Mazlish.

WebSep 23, 2024 · The Need To Be Perfect. We often see siblings of special needs kids being competitive to be the best or being a classic example of a “perfectionist.” These kids are extremely special, but they place so much added stress on themselves because of everything they see you as a parent going through. WebSep 7, 2016 · Sibling Conflict Overload? Siblings play a significant role in each others’ lives. These relationships are complex for many reasons. Disability adds further complexity that can be both positive and negative. On the positive side, siblings of children with special needs may develop profound compassion, insight, tolerance and appreciation for ... WebSome kids with disabilities have significant behavioral challenges. Make sure your other kids are safe. Address siblings concerns about the future. One of the most common concerns of siblings of the disabled as they move into later adulthood is knowing the plan of action for the disabled sibling.

WebSibling panels, books, blogs and films are excellent ways to learn more about sibling issues. Encourage parents to reassure their typically-developing children by planning for the future of the child with special needs. Early in life, brothers and sisters worry about what obligations they will have toward their sibling in the days to come. WebDec 18, 2024 · A group often overlooked by UK schools are siblings of children with a disability, special educational needs or a serious long-term condition (hereinafter referred to as SEND). It has been estimated that approximately 7-17 per cent of children are siblings of children with a chronic condition/disability (McKenzie Smith et al., 2024).
